Overview of Guinness World Records 2023
Published in September 2022, this 256‑page edition explores both cosmic and terrestrial wonders across several themed chapters Barrington BooksHarvard. It is packed with vibrant photography, infographics, and 3D‑style “snapshot” features offering epic visual comparisons of record holders against famous landmarks Barnes & NobleBarrington Books.
🔍 Chapter Highlights
Space: Opens with a space‑focused tour of astronomical records—including the New Space Race, pioneering space tourists, next‑generation rockets, the James Webb Space Telescope and the longest‑operating lunar rover Barnes & NobleDawn.
‑Natural World: Highlights the most extraordinary animals—majestic, bizarre, and record‑breaking—paired with breathtaking birdlife and wildlife superlatives Barnes & NobleDawn.
Human Body & Extraordinary Exploits: Profiles record‑breakers like the tallest, shortest, strongest, hairiest, and even mermaids, alongside stunt‑artists, jugglers, climbers and other phenomenal performers Barnes & Noblereadplus.com.au.
Around the World in 300 Records: Celebrates the 150th anniversary of Around the World in 80 Days, featuring 300 cultural/geographic highlights—from the oldest rainforests to iconic tourist landmarks Barnes & Noblereadplus.com.au.
Epic Engineering & Modern World: Covers innovations from fast food and TikTok fame to cryptocurrency and tech disruptors, plus a curated list of the top 25 gaming records spanning from classics like Pac‑Man to Minecraft and Fortnite Barnes & Nobleparnassusbooks.net.
Sports: Concludes with a 30‑page roundup of all the latest sporting achievements as of its publication Barnes & NobleBarrington Books.

Notable 2023 Record Stories
World’s Oldest Dog “Bobi” was certified at 31 years and 163 days in early 2023 before his death, though veterinary experts later raised concerns about the verifiability of his age WIRED.
Cook‑a‑thon Record: Nigerian chef Hilda Baci set a marathon cooking record of 93 hours, 11 minutes, which was later surpassed in late 2023 by Irish chef Alan Fisher with a 119‑hour record Wikipedia.
Volcanic Seven Summits: In mid‑2023, Australian climber Caroline Leon became the fastest woman to summit the highest volcanoes on each continent—completing in 183 days Wikipedia.
Tandem Push‑up Challenge: Greek athlete George Kotsimpos and partner Apostolos Dervas broke multiple tandem push‑up records in 2022 and 2023, including reaching 51 consecutive reps Wikipedia.
